8 Ways You Can Enhance Customer Experience For A Shopify Store

1. Delight Your Consumers

Know that increasing your customer’s retention rate also increases your profits. Businesses that realize the significance of retaining customers work tirelessly to provide their existing customers a seamless experience. Among the chief ways to delight your customers include the following:

  • E-mail rewards or loyalty points after they purchase products and which they can redeem at a later time
  • Thank you emails after your customers shop, or handwritten thank-you gift cards
  • A referral program that will provide benefits to both your existing consumers and new customers
  • Free gifts like t-shirts, mugs, and keychains along with your loyal customers’ orders

2. Give Your Shoppers A Suprise

Who will reject surprises? People love surprises. Online shoppers like surprises. And with these surprises, you can improve the customer experience. Some of these surprises include offering free shipping, enhancing your sales, and so much more. You can let them know of these surprises at the checkout stage. They will encourage shoppers to purchase from your store again and also help spread your offer by word-of-mouth.

Moreover, you can also use this strategy for abandoned carts. Instead of sending your customers the usual “We miss you” e-mails, you can surprise them with incentives so they will complete the buyer’s journey toward making the purchase.

3. Up Your Social Media Strategy

Nowadays, eCommerce stores are going beyond their respective websites. They also are present on social media. Social media lets eCommerce brands project their distinctive brand voice. If you do not have the resources yet for a social media team, you can allot a specific time within the day to respond to social media inquiries about your store. Be sure to address each question, and respond to reviews you receive on Facebook, Twitter, Instagram, Pinterest, and more, whether these are positive or negative reviews.

Be proactive with your social media game. Instead of picking up a fight, respond positively to a negative post about your store and products.

5. Relay An Omnichannel Customer Experience

This may sound a bit technical, so let us get down to it gradually. Your customers are present across various channels online. You should also be. Delivering a successful omnichannel experience for your customers is the path to take.

Did you know that omnichannel marketing can improve your conversions greatly? To do this, ensure that the needed contact details like email addresses are visible on your official website.

Omnichannel marketing also involves incorporating live chats and widgets on your site to communicate with your consumers in real-time. If you do not hold ample time to answer their queries personally, you can invest in chatbots that provide automated responses.

6. Adhere To An Impactful Content Strategy

The objective of content marketing is to help shoppers solve their biggest issues. You can improve your content marketing by incorporating blog posts, interviews, tips, infographics, videos, and the like related to the products you sell. For instance, if your eCommerce store sells fashion products, you can create content that provides style advice, tips, lookbooks, latest fashion trends, and the like. Then, make certain you plan this out on your content calendar.

7. Personalize The Customer Experience

Today, it is all about personalization. Personalized emails are no longer enough to enhance your customer experience. Instead, you need to personalize the shopping experience throughout your buyers’ journeys based on various variables. To do this, use recommendation engines to suggest personalized product recommendations according to the user’s shopping habits, location, and browsing history.

Aside from this, you may also use exit intent pop-ups, abandoned cart messages, discounts, and the like to ensure your customer experience game is always on-point.
